Twitter India's public policy director Mahima Kaul has resigned from her post. He has resigned for personal reasons. Mahima Kaul joined the micro-blogging site Twitter in the year 2015. According to the news received, Mahima resigned from her post in early January. Currently, she will be associated with Twitter till the end of March. According to sources, Mahima is taking a break of some time from work.

The news of Mahima Kaul's resignation has come amidst the constant questioning of social media. Over the years, Twitter had to answer many questions on issues like hate speech. Recently, the Government of India took to Twitter to target the farmers' movement for not removing the fake and inflammatory tweets.

The government has warned of strict action against not blocking about 250 accounts of tweeting from Twitter. There has been a deadlock over deleting tweets or blocking accounts. The government has hinted that it may become more stringent in the coming times with fake and inflammatory tweets.
